Benefits

Fungal skin infections / Treatment of Fungal infectionsFungal skin infections / Treatment of Fungal infections

In Fungal skin infections : Flu Well 1% Soap is an antifungal medicine. It kills and prevents the growth of fungus. This relieves the symptoms caused by the infection. It may be used to treat infections such as ringworm, athlete�s foot, fungal nappy rash, and fungal sweat rash. You should keep using it for as long as it is prescribed even if your symptoms have gone. This will prevent the infection from coming back. Using this medicine as prescribed will relieve pain and itching and may help you feel more comfortable with your skin.In Treatment of Fungal infections Flu Well 1% Soap is an antifungal medicine. It works by killing and stopping the growth of fungi that causes the infection. It helps treat infections of the mouth, throat, vagina, and other parts of the body.The dose and duration of treatment will depend on what you are being treated for. Make sure you complete the full course of treatment. How it works

How Flu Well Soap works Flu Well 1% Soap is an antifungal medication which treats skin infections. It works by killing the fungi on the skin by destroying their cell membrane. Flu Well 1% Soap is an antifungal used to treat various fungal skin infections, including ringworm, athlete's foot, fungal nappy rash, and vulvar irritation associated with thrush.
Flu Well 1% Soap is effective against Trichophyton species, causing ringworm and athlete's foot, and Candida, which causes vaginal thrush.
No, continue using Flu Well 1% Soap as prescribed, even if symptoms improve, to ensure the infection is fully treated.
Flu Well 1% Soap may reduce the effectiveness of rubber contraceptives. Use alternative contraception for at least 5 days after application if used on the vulva or penis.
Avoid contact with eyes and mouth, and do not use if allergic to it. Inform your doctor of any allergic reactions or other medications you are taking. Do not cover the treated area with a bandage, and do not exceed the recommended dosage. Pregnant or breastfeeding women should use it only if prescribed.
Symptoms like itching should improve within a few days, but signs such as redness may take longer. Continue using Flu Well 1% Soap for the full duration prescribed by your doctor.
Keep affected areas clean and dry, avoid scratching, and do not share personal items like towels to prevent spreading the infection.
Treatment duration varies: typically 1 month for tinea infections and at least 15 days for candida infections. Do not stop early, as the infection may return.
